Understanding Insider Threats in Healthcare

Insider threats in healthcare refer to security risks posed by individuals within an organization, such as employees, contractors, and vendors, who have authorized access to sensitive data and systems. These threats can be intentional or unintentional, leading to significant consequences, particularly regarding patient information. A staggering 51% of healthcare organizations reported experiencing six or more insider attacks in the past year, with remediation costs exceeding $1 million for nearly a third of those affected. The difficulty in detecting these threats is underscored by the fact that 37% of organizations find insider threats harder to identify than external attacks, with breaches taking an average of 178 days to discover.

AI-Powered Detection Systems

Artificial intelligence (AI) is increasingly being utilized to enhance the detection of insider threats in healthcare settings. Traditional security tools often rely on predefined rules and manual monitoring, which can be slow and ineffective. In contrast, AI systems can analyze vast amounts of data in real-time to identify behavioral anomalies indicative of potential threats.

Key AI Techniques in Insider Threat Detection

1. Real-Time Anomaly Detection: AI systems can be trained to recognize normal user behavior across various roles and departments, flagging any deviations that may indicate suspicious activity.

2. Behavioral Analytics: By building user profiles based on typical working hours and system interactions, AI can assess risks when users deviate from their established routines.

3. Natural Language Processing (NLP): AI tools can analyze text-based communications, such as emails and chat messages, for signs of policy violations or malicious intent, thereby enhancing monitoring capabilities while maintaining compliance with privacy regulations.

4. Automated Response and Incident Triage: AI can streamline the investigation of suspicious activities by automating incident triage and response workflows, ensuring timely action is taken to mitigate potential damage.

Integration with Electronic Health Records (EHR)

The integration of AI with EHR systems is crucial for enhancing insider threat detection. EHRs contain sensitive patient data and are prime targets for insider threats. AI tools continuously monitor user interactions with EHRs, automate compliance checks, and identify unusual billing patterns, thereby strengthening defenses against potential breaches.

The Growing Importance of AI in Healthcare Security

As healthcare organizations increasingly digitize their operations, the risks associated with insider threats are expected to rise. AI provides a proactive approach to monitoring, detecting, and responding to these internal risks, allowing healthcare leaders to safeguard patient data more effectively. In 2023, 43% of medical groups reported expanding their use of AI, particularly for security automation and incident response.
